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

AWS (Amazon Web Services)

  • Data transfer in is free and data transfer out is charged, which is the standard source of unexpected bills
  • Discounts require one or three year Savings Plan commitments rather than being automatic
  • Every service is priced separately, so a working architecture has no single published cost
  • The free tier is a promotional allowance rather than an ongoing free plan

Terragrunt

  • Additional complexity layer on top of Terraform
  • Requires understanding of Terraform concepts
  • Paid tier pricing not clearly published

AWS (Amazon Web Services): What are AWS's payment options and pricing models?

AWS offers four pricing approaches: pay-as-you-go (you pay only for what you use), flat-rate plans combining multiple services into one monthly price without overages, Savings Plans offering discounts on compute and machine learning with 1- or 3-year commitments, and volume-based tiered pricing where costs decrease as usage increases.

Terragrunt: Is Terragrunt free?

Yes, the Terragrunt CLI is completely free and open source. Terragrunt Scale offers a free tier for up to 25 infrastructure units.

AWS (Amazon Web Services): Are there contracts, termination fees, or commitments required for AWS?

No long-term contracts are required for AWS services. No termination fees apply once you stop using the service. Savings Plans provide optional 1- or 3-year commitments with discounted hourly rates, but you can revert to pay-as-you-go pricing anytime.

Terragrunt: What is the difference between Terragrunt and Terraform?

Terragrunt is an orchestration layer on top of Terraform that handles state management, DRY principles, and deployment automation without replacing Terraform itself.

AWS (Amazon Web Services): How do I estimate my AWS costs?

AWS provides the AWS Pricing Calculator and Cost Explorer tool to estimate costs for single or multiple services. AWS also offers cost optimization recommendations, performance reporting, and budget alerts to help track and control spending.
